// Code generated by software.amazon.smithy.rust.codegen.smithy-rs. DO NOT EDIT.
impl super::Client {
/// Constructs a fluent builder for the [`TestRenderTemplate`](crate::operation::test_render_template::builders::TestRenderTemplateFluentBuilder) operation.
///
/// - The fluent builder is configurable:
/// - [`template_name(impl Into<String>)`](crate::operation::test_render_template::builders::TestRenderTemplateFluentBuilder::template_name) / [`set_template_name(Option<String>)`](crate::operation::test_render_template::builders::TestRenderTemplateFluentBuilder::set_template_name):<br>required: **true**<br><p>The name of the template to render.</p><br>
/// - [`template_data(impl Into<String>)`](crate::operation::test_render_template::builders::TestRenderTemplateFluentBuilder::template_data) / [`set_template_data(Option<String>)`](crate::operation::test_render_template::builders::TestRenderTemplateFluentBuilder::set_template_data):<br>required: **true**<br><p>A list of replacement values to apply to the template. This parameter is a JSON object, typically consisting of key-value pairs in which the keys correspond to replacement tags in the email template.</p><br>
/// - On success, responds with [`TestRenderTemplateOutput`](crate::operation::test_render_template::TestRenderTemplateOutput) with field(s):
/// - [`rendered_template(Option<String>)`](crate::operation::test_render_template::TestRenderTemplateOutput::rendered_template): <p>The complete MIME message rendered by applying the data in the TemplateData parameter to the template specified in the TemplateName parameter.</p>
/// - On failure, responds with [`SdkError<TestRenderTemplateError>`](crate::operation::test_render_template::TestRenderTemplateError)
pub fn test_render_template(&self) -> crate::operation::test_render_template::builders::TestRenderTemplateFluentBuilder {
crate::operation::test_render_template::builders::TestRenderTemplateFluentBuilder::new(self.handle.clone())
}
}